Output aabc80d947499e39a9d2629923ea426666e30cce7c450666c64eba85d5de965d:17

value
283587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0139989225b00179f67dd488e1d320278e7f663c OP_EQUALVERIFY OP_CHECKSIG
address
17Ug2nD153KF45pRrTebtZxchwTp31dm4
transaction
aabc80d947499e39a9d2629923ea426666e30cce7c450666c64eba85d5de965d
spent
true